    Can My Tax Id Number Be Used In Another State By Another?

    I have a tax id. My friend want to use it. This is for temporary purposes until he gets started, with his business. Is this legal? Can some one use my id with my permission for such purposes?

      No. A tax ID number is for the entity it was issued to only. By letting someone else use this number you are subjecting yourself to potential tax liability as well as many other legal and financial issues. The number is your until you die, the company is closed and the number retired or both. Do not let anyone use your tax ID number even if it is a State as opposed to a federal number. MAJOR PROBLEMS!
